PASSING SHIP [1 record]

Record 1 2015-03-17

English

Subject field(s)
  • Water Transport
CONT

... a "passing" ship is one proceeding on a parallel or nearly parallel course with the other, so that her red light or green light is immediately behind the other, or which, at night sees the red light without the green light, or the green light without the red light of the other.
